Rising Childcare Costs Prompt Parents in Wales to Make Tough Choices

As the election approaches, many parents in Wales are expressing deep concern over the rising costs of childcare. These expenses are becoming a major issue, influencing decisions about work and family care.

One mother mentioned that her husband may consider leaving his job to stay home and care for their children due to the financial strain of nursery fees. This situation is not unique; numerous families across Wales are feeling the pressure from soaring childcare costs, which are among the highest in the UK.

The increase in childcare expenses is forcing parents to rethink their work-life balance. For many, the choice between continuing their careers or managing the high costs of childcare is a difficult one. This financial burden is making it hard for some parents to return to work after having children.

Many families are now prioritizing budget cuts and looking for alternative arrangements to ease the financial strain. Some are considering family support or part-time work options to avoid high nursery fees.

As the election draws near, candidates are being urged to address this issue and propose solutions that can alleviate the burden on families. The rising childcare costs are not just a personal struggle; they are becoming a political matter that could shape the future of family support in Wales.
